Regina man accidentally fires weapon, ends up with weapons charge

The accidental discharge of a firearm in an apartment in Regina has led to a 26-year-old man getting charged with discharging a restricted or prohibited firearm in a residence recklessly.
Police received a call from the man, Elmer Wilson, just before 6 p.m., admitting he’d accidentally discharged his weapon.
Regina police then went to the apartment. The projectile didn’t travel out of the apartment and there were no injuries.
Police seized that firearm and three others… all of which were legally owned.
Wilson made his first appearance on the charges today in Regina provincial court.
